Apple is indicating that there are several chess products for Widgets.
Sigma Chess with or without HIARCS is free. Limited to 1000 games per file.
Sigma has a feature which will indicate Mate.

GNU Chess:
GNU is an old product. Version 2 goes back to June 1991. Apple no longer supports the product. Version 2.4.1 according to the program last supported 2003, which is pre-OS 10.5.

CM 9000 for Macintosh is equivalent to CM 10 for Windows. CM9000 is the only Chess Master that will work with OS X.
